Output dd84590a5abd99086cd22b8213f999a0b85878a00806c828de659420d5573aaf:3

value
354294
script pubkey
OP_0 OP_PUSHBYTES_20 f1872c6c66641f06c95f1692a97346bbfe918474
address
tb1q7xrjcmrxvs0sdj2lz6f2ju6xh0lfrpr5mt0nqt
transaction
dd84590a5abd99086cd22b8213f999a0b85878a00806c828de659420d5573aaf